MH17 flight report due in October

August 27, 2015 – It is being reported today that a report on MH17 is due out in October.  Malaysia Flt17 was shot out of the sky on July 17, 2014.

The Dutch officials in charge of the investigation of what happened to MH17 have announce that they will be publicizing their report on October 13, 2015.

Relatives of the passengers on the doomed flight will be informed before the public.  Authorities have written out their conclusions of exactly what happened based on the evidence.  The Malaysian plane was shot down as it flew over the active attacks between the Ukraine and Russia.

All 298 people aboard the flight were killed when it crash landed in the Ukraine, mostly Dutch citizens.  “The Netherlands has been leading teams of international investigators to retrieve body parts, probe the cause of the incident and eventually prosecute those responsible.”

Many in the West believe pro-Russian rebels blew up the Boeing 777 with a BUK missile supplied by Russia.  However, Moscow has denied any responsibility and blames the pro-Ukraine fighters.

“Dutch prosecutors leading the criminal probe, assisted by experts from Australia, Belgium, Malaysia and the Ukraine . . announced they have found fragments ‘probably’ from a Russian-made surface-to-air missile at the crash site.”
